At BodySpec our Mobile Health Techs (MHTs) are at the center of the service we provide to clients. Each and every day our MHTs operate our mobile van clinics across LA, San Francisco, Seattle, Dallas, and Austin, delivering medical-grade scans to clients. Their day to day involves both operations (driving, operating the device, troubleshooting) and client success (greeting clients, making them feel comfortable, and communicating information). Our Mobile Health Leads lead these teams towards operational excellence and delivering an exceptional client experience.
